interoperable
Meanings
-
adjective
Capable of exchanging and using information with other systems or applications.
-
Able to work together or connect seamlessly.

Data interoperability: The ability of different systems, applications, or organizations to exchange, process, and understand data.
-
Semantic interoperability: The ability of different systems to understand and interpret the meaning of data.
